Output 8c39208ba6fe89304755f99b949bba05525e6602e915356d2d7a7e0beab9a42c:1

value
27184
script pubkey
OP_0 OP_PUSHBYTES_20 160439aaf9b9f96d8bebde55f5e4bc3c167ce5a2
address
tb1qzczrn2heh8ukmzltme2lte9u8st8eedzrlhhel
transaction
8c39208ba6fe89304755f99b949bba05525e6602e915356d2d7a7e0beab9a42c
confirmations
27825
spent
true